WebThe two most common types of eating disorders, anorexia and bulimia most commonly emerge during adolescence or young adulthood. When these illnesses linger into a woman’s reproductive years they can adversely impact not only her health but also her baby’s. It is critical to understand the impact of eating disorders and pregnancy.

Vitamin B12 Needed for: Supporting nerve cells and red blood cells. How much per day: 2.6 micrograms. What to eat: Fortified cereals or soy milk, milk and yogurt, eggs or fortified nutritional yeast.
